  • Steve Freebairn

    September 26, 2005 at 6:57 pm

    There are newer versions of the drivers for the RTX100 that have to be used with Premiere Pro, If you are using PPro 1.5 then you need drivers 6122. They are available from matrox.com

  • Andre Gagnon

    September 26, 2005 at 8:12 pm

    The drivers may be found from this link:

    https://www.matrox.com/video/support/rtx100xtremepro/software/home.cfm

    Note that the choice of drivers depends on the Premiere version.

    That is:

    Premiere 6.5–> ver. 4263
    Premiere 1.0–> ver. 5078
    Premiere 1.5–> ver. 6122
